velocity values in sample header

Hi!
For some reason, sample header does not remember velocity vales that I write in it.
When I reopen the sound, base pitch is as I stated, but velocity values are 0 again
Am I doing something wrong?

Hi Samuel,
Could you please tell us what format your sample file is in? Was it WAVE?
Thanks!
Hi SSC,
thanx for the reply.
Yes, it was "wav".
I converted it to "aiff", and that solved the problem.
